Tacos: The Quintessential Road Food



Tacos are commonly considered as the essential road food of Mexico, commemorated for their convenience and abundant flavors. They include a simple tortilla, usually made from corn or flour, loaded with a selection of ingredients that can vary from smoked meats to vegetables. This versatility allows for many local variants, each showcasing regional flavors and traditions.


Popular fillings consist of carne asada, carnitas, and pollo, often accompanied by fresh garnishes like cilantro, onions, and lime. Street vendors expertly prepare and offer tacos, making them a economical and convenient option for locals and travelers alike.


The experience of consuming tacos is enhanced by the vibrant ambience of Mexican roads, where the scent of flavors and sizzling meat fills up the air. This famous meal not just pleases hunger yet additionally represents the social splendor of Mexico, mirroring its history, neighborhood, and cooking virtuosity.


Mole: A Symphony of Flavors



Mole symbolizes the intricacy and deepness of Mexican cuisine, offering a rich tapestry of tastes that astound the taste buds. This sauce, often made with a blend of chilies, seasonings, nuts, and chocolate, showcases the virtuosity and social heritage of Mexico. Each region flaunts its distinct interpretation, with variants such as mole poblano and mole , mirroring local active ingredients and traditions.


The prep work of mole is an elaborate process, needing ability and patience as the components are carefully toasted, ground, and simmered to perfection. The resulting sauce can vary from savory to sweet, with layers of flavor that advance with each bite. Generally offered over poultry or turkey, mole goes beyond mere nutrition, typically beautifying unique occasions and parties. Its dynamic color and facility profile signify the rich cooking identification of Mexico, making it an important dish that reverberates with both residents and site visitors alike.


Pozole: A Hearty Practice



Although commonly appreciated throughout festive gatherings, pozole is a dish deeply rooted in Mexican custom, embodying both cultural significance and communal spirit. This passionate soup, made mostly from hominy, meat-- normally pork or hen-- and an abundant broth, has old origins that map back to pre-Columbian civilizations. Commonly gotten ready for celebrations such as Mexican Self-reliance Day and wedding events, pozole transcends simple nourishment, cultivating a sense of unity among those who take part.


The recipe comes in different local variations, consisting of pozole rojo, verde, and blanco, each identified by its special ingredients and flavor profiles. Toppings such as shredded cabbage, radishes, avocado, and lime boost the recipe, enabling individual expression. Beyond its scrumptious top qualities, pozole acts as a symbol of heritage, attaching generations via shared dishes and cooking methods. Its preparation commonly comes to be a public occasion, reinforcing bonds among household and buddies, making it a true emblem of Mexican hospitality.


Tamales: Covered in Love



Tamales hold a special place in Mexican food, similar to pozole, celebrating custom and neighborhood. These delightful parcels of masa, or corn dough, are commonly filled with a variety of ingredients, consisting of take out and delivery meats, cheeses, veggies, or fruits, and after that wrapped in corn husks or banana leaves before being steamed to perfection - lunch and dinner. The preparation of tamales frequently involves household events, where generations integrated to share the labor of mixing, filling, and covering, enhancing their value as a public recipe


Tamales are particularly preferred throughout festive events, such as Christmas and Día de los Muertos, signifying a link to social heritage. They are not just food; they symbolize love, treatment, and the giving of culinary skills. Each area in Mexico flaunts its very own special variants, showcasing local flavors and customs, making tamales a precious staple that transcends generations and unifies people throughout the country.


Ceviche: A Fresh Coastal Pleasure







Ceviche, a vivid recipe rooted in the seaside areas of Mexico, showcases the quality of the sea's bounty. Traditionally made with raw fish seasoned in citrus juices, specifically lime, ceviche is celebrated for its invigorating taste account. The level of acidity from the lime "cooks" the fish, leading to a tender texture that sets wonderfully with the intense active ingredients frequently included, such as diced tomatoes, onions, cilantro, and chili peppers.


Regions like Baja The Golden State and the Yucatán Peninsula have their own distinct versions, incorporating local fish and shellfish such as shrimp, octopus, or scallops. Served chilled, ceviche is usually accompanied by tortilla chips or tostadas, boosting its charm as a preferred appetizer or light dish. This recipe not only mirrors the abundant marine life of Mexico yet likewise highlights the cultural importance of fresh, local components in Mexican gastronomy. Ceviche stays a beloved representation of coastal cooking practices.
